FAQ: Keywheel rotation utility

Q: What if Keywheel aborts mid-rotation and the store stays sealed?

A: This happens when a rotation batch is interrupted. First check the journal for the last committed epoch, then roll back any half-written entries before unsealing. Unsealing the store after an aborted rotation requires the recovery passphrase recorded immediately below.

unlock words, hafop-tahog: drumir-druiel-kasox-wenax-tamys-frair

Welcome to on-call for the Glimmerpane design system! Our snapshot tests live in the `snapcheck` suite and run on every merge to main. If a UI component changes visually, the diff bot flags it — usually it's an intentional tweak, so just approve the new baseline. If it's 2am and snapshots are failing across the board, it's almost always a font-loading race, not your problem. To unlock the baseline store and re-approve snapshots in bulk, use the recovery passphrase below.

recovery phrase for tahag-taguf: wenix-caswyn

# Environments: Pellwick Notifier

Welcome aboard! The fan-out workers push notifications to a few million devices, and when downstream providers slow down, backpressure kicks in fast. Staging is deliberately throttled so you can see the queue-depth limiter trip without paging anyone. Production uses much looser thresholds, tuned after last spring's pile-up. If workers stall, compare against the canonical values first. The current production backpressure configuration for Pellwick is listed below.

deployment values, yadug-bawif:
[framir]
team = pelox
access_code = ac_a38ab2
owner = tamion.julael
host = framir.tolvaqlabs.test
port = 11211
peer = tammir.zemvargrid.local
salt = 2215ef03
pin = 1541